CVE-2026-35177 is a high-severity vulnerability rated 7.1/10 on the CVSS scale. Vim is an open source, command line text editor. Prior to 9.2.0280, a path traversal bypass in Vim's zip.vim plugin allows overwriting of arbitrary files when opening specially crafted zip archives, circumventing the previous fix for CVE-2025-53906. EPSS estimates a 0.13% chance of exploitation in the next 30 days.
